As a child, Lovelace's tutors and governesses were all instructed to teach her the "discipline" of mathematics and music in such a way that Lovelace would never find the love of writing that her father possessed. For fear that Lovelace would develop the same mood swings and torments that her father had, Lovelace was not allowed to really read her father's poetry...

There were claims that Annabella, as her mother was called, kept Lord Byron's poetry in a case that Lovelace could access at anytime. She was even encouraged to read the poetry later on in life, but the "discipline," as Annabella called it, of mathematics had been instilled into Lovelace and her spark for poetry was smothered...
